LCD Laminating: Techniques & Troubleshooting

LCD laminating is a critical operation in display fabrication, requiring careful technique to ensure superior visual performance. Common approaches include heat adhering and continuous equipment. Troubleshooting typical issues like air pockets, delamination, or inconsistent sticking often necessitates complete examination of surface treatment, bonding agent selection, and laminating setting correction. Maintaining stable ambient settings, such as warmth and moisture, is also essential for positive results.

COF Bonding Machine: Precision for LCD Assembly

The increasing demand for high-resolution LCD screens necessitates precise Chip-on-Flex (COF) sealing methods. A COF attachment machine provides a vital role in achieving this standard of accuracy. These modern machines incorporate robotic systems and innovative vision verification to firmly fasten the COF tape to the LCD substrate. Important characteristics include high-speed throughput, even bond strength, and minimal strain on the delicate LCD component.

Understanding LCD Lamination Processes

LCD panel adhesion techniques involve accurately positioning a active crystal panel to a protective substrate. This critical procedure usually uses specialized equipment and meticulous control of variables such as warmth, force, and humidity. Various methods, including continuous and individual systems, are utilized depending on the volume and sort of display being created. Achieving a defect-free bond ensures the best image performance and lifespan of the finished device.
